Police have discovered two claymore mines in Jaffna, each weighing 15 kilograms upon questioning of a former LTTE cadre who was arrested last week.
The former LTTE cadre, had been arrested in Seru Nuwara, Trincomalee, after which his wife and sister had been arrested with explosives and ammunition at his residence in Kilinochchi.
Police Spokesman Ruwan Gunasekara said that the claymore mines had been buried behind a land area in Kondavil, Jaffna.
The suspects are being questioned by the Terrorist Investigation Division.
